In the December 22, 2025 episode, viewers are plunged back into the damp, suffocating depths of the Demira catacombs, where Chad DiMera, Kristen DiMera, Theo Carver, and their fellow captives are forced to confront the unthinkable truth: their tormentor is Peter Blake. The revelation hits like a gut punch. For years, Peter has existed as a ghost of Salem’s past, a name synonymous with manipulation and madness. Now, he stands before them, very much alive—and terrifyingly in control.

The Vial That Sparks Terror
The tension escalates to unbearable levels when Peter produces a small vial from his pocket. The moment it appears, fear ripples through the group. The object is simple—but its implications are endless.
Is it poison? A sedative? A tool of execution? Or, cruelly ironic, something that could save Kristen’s life?
Peter offers no clarity, letting the ambiguity do the work for him. The vial becomes a psychological weapon, a symbol of Peter’s absolute power over their fate. The uncertainty is more horrifying than any explicit threat—and it pushes one man to the brink.

Kristen Strikes Back Against Her Brother
Watching Theo fall ignites something primal in Kristen. Fevered, shaking, and nearly delirious, she refuses to let another person suffer at Peter’s hands. Drawing on a reserve of strength no one—including Peter—expected, Kristen lunges at her brother.
Armed with a jagged piece of wood scavenged from the catacombs, she attacks with ferocity born of fear, rage, and betrayal. This is not a calculated move—it’s pure instinct. Each strike carries the weight of her captivity, her terror for Rachel, and the unbearable realization that her own flesh and blood is responsible.
Peter is completely caught off guard. He underestimated Kristen’s will to survive—and it costs him dearly. The blows land hard and fast until he collapses, incapacitated on the stone floor.
In a stunning reversal, the captor becomes the captive.
Power Shifts Underground
The survivors waste no time. Chad and the others quickly restrain Peter, binding him with whatever materials they can find. For the first time since their nightmare began, they have the upper hand.

Ripple Effects Above Ground: Salem in Crisis
While chaos reigns below, Salem above is unraveling. The disappearance of so many DiMeras sends shockwaves through the town. The FBI and Salem PD scramble to track down Chad, Kristen, Theo, EJ, Tony, and Peter—realizing this is no isolated incident, but a systematic strike against one of Salem’s most powerful families.

At the Horton House, the emotional fallout is just as devastating. Julie Williams makes the heartbreaking decision to postpone the beloved Horton Christmas ornament tradition. Without Chad, the joy feels hollow. For Thomas and Charlotte, the absence of their father overshadows everything. The delay isn’t just symbolic—it raises the stakes for Chad’s safe return and underscores the show’s core truth: family presence matters more than tradition.
